RunwayMLAI直播特效教程详解
时间:2025-09-30 20:06:51 377浏览 收藏
想要在直播中玩转AI特效?本教程将带你轻松掌握RunwayML,实现吸睛的动态视觉效果。本文详细介绍了如何利用RunwayML创建AI直播特效,从准备直播输入源、加载AI模型,到调整参数、配置虚拟摄像头输出,一步步教你将创意变为现实。无论是实时背景移除、风格迁移,还是更复杂的复合特效,都能通过RunwayML轻松实现。文章还针对常见问题,如画面无法正常显示或应用效果,提供了故障排除指南。即使是新手,也能快速上手,为直播内容增添更多趣味和互动性,打造个性化直播体验。
首先确保输入源正确连接,再依次加载AI模型、调整参数、配置虚拟摄像头输出,最后可通过串联多模型实现复杂特效。具体为:1. 在RunwayML中创建Live Feed项目并选择摄像头或NDI输入;2. 从模型库添加如“Background Removal”等实时模型并等待加载完成;3. 调整边缘平滑度等参数并启用实时预览,必要时降低分辨率以减少延迟;4. 设置输出为目标为“Virtual Camera”,启动流并在OBS等软件中选择“Runway Virtual Device”作为视频源;5. 可进一步添加如“Style Transfer”模型并与前一模型连接,实现去背景加艺术化风格的复合特效输出。

如果您尝试在直播中使用RunwayML生成AI动态特效,但无法正常显示或应用效果,则可能是由于输入源设置错误、模型加载失败或输出配置不当。以下是实现AI直播动态特效的具体步骤:
一、准备直播输入源
确保RunwayML能够接收实时视频流是实现动态特效的前提。该步骤旨在将摄像头或外部采集设备的信号正确导入RunwayML平台。
1、打开RunwayML桌面应用程序并登录账户。
2、点击左侧菜单栏中的“+ New Project”创建新项目。
3、选择“Live Feed”模式,并在弹出窗口中选择摄像头设备或NDI/O输入源作为视频输入。
4、确认画面预览窗口中出现实时影像,表示输入源已成功连接。
二、加载AI动态特效模型
RunwayML提供多种预训练AI模型用于实时视觉处理,此步骤用于选择并激活适合直播场景的动态特效模型。
1、在项目界面点击“Models”标签,进入模型库。
2、在搜索框中输入特效类型关键词,如“Green Screen”、“Pose Estimation”或“Style Transfer”。
3、从结果中选择一个支持实时处理的模型,例如“Background Removal”,点击“Add to Project”进行加载。
4、等待模型完全加载完毕,观察状态指示灯变为绿色,表示模型已就绪。
三、调整特效参数与实时预览
为使特效更符合直播需求,需对模型输出参数进行个性化调节,并通过预览功能验证效果。
1、点击已加载的模型模块,展开右侧参数控制面板。
2、根据需要调整阈值、边缘平滑度或色彩映射等选项。
3、启用“Real-time Preview”功能,查看叠加特效后的实时画面。
4、若发现延迟过高,可降低分辨率设置至720p或以下以提升帧率稳定性。
四、配置虚拟摄像机输出
将带有AI特效的视频流输出为虚拟摄像头信号,以便其他直播软件识别和使用。
1、在RunwayML输出设置中选择“Virtual Camera”作为输出目标。
2、点击“Start Streaming”按钮,启动虚拟摄像头服务。
3、打开OBS、Zoom或Teams等应用程序,在视频源设置中选择“Runway Virtual Device”作为摄像头输入。
4、确认画面中显示带特效的实时影像,表明输出配置成功。
五、多模型串联实现复合特效
通过连接多个AI模型形成处理链路,可以实现更复杂的动态视觉效果,如人物分割后叠加风格化背景。
1、在项目工作区中添加第二个AI模型,例如“Style Transfer”。
2、将“Background Removal”模型的输出端口拖拽连接到“Style Transfer”的输入端口。
3、为“Style Transfer”模型指定风格图像样本,并启用实时渲染。
4、最终输出将呈现去除背景并应用艺术化处理的动态画面,可通过虚拟摄像头输出至直播平台。
以上就是《RunwayMLAI直播特效教程详解》的详细内容,更多关于RunwayML,虚拟摄像头,AI直播特效,实时模型,动态视觉效果的资料请关注golang学习网公众号!
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
273 收藏
-
251 收藏
-
205 收藏
-
323 收藏
-
457 收藏
-
314 收藏
-
370 收藏
-
132 收藏
-
339 收藏
-
413 收藏
-
394 收藏
-
436 收藏
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 立即学习 543次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 立即学习 516次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 立即学习 500次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 立即学习 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 立即学习 485次学习